Education law is a vital area that governs the policies, rights, and responsibilities within our educational systems. It covers a wide range of issues, including student rights, special education services, school discipline, teacher contracts, and the legal obligations of educational institutions. Its core purpose is to ensure equal access to education and maintain a safe, fair, and inclusive learning environment for all.
Many are unaware of the legal protections in place for students and educators alike. Education law addresses critical matters such as discrimination, bullying, academic integrity, and the rights of students with disabilities. It empowers families to advocate for their children’s educational needs and ensures that schools uphold their legal responsibilities.
